Wabanaki Public Health & Wellness (WPHW) is growing, and we are excited to be adding new people to our team!  If you value inclusivity, balance, and cultural centeredness and have a true passion for serving others, you may be a great fit for our team!  WPHW is a non-profit organization that serves four federally recognized tribes located in five communities:  the Houlton Band of Maliseet Indians, the Aroostook Band of Mi'kmaq, the Passamaquoddy Tribe at Indian Township, the Passamaquoddy Tribe at Pleasant Point, and the Penobscot Nation.  Wabanaki traditions, language, and culture guide our approach and describe the ways we live in harmony with each other and the land we collectively share.  Services are available to community members living on and off-reservation across the State of Maine.

Position Summary:


This position will promote wellness and healthy lifestyles by designing and implementing public health prevention programming related to commercial tobacco prevention, traditional tobacco education, and healthy eating and active living programs. 


Duties and Responsibilities:

    •  Develop new and strengthen existing partnerships with community-based agencies to provide commercial tobacco prevention, traditional tobacco education, healthy eating and active living initiatives, including nutrition education programs 
    • Partner with tribal schools, childcare centers, out-of-school programs, community centers, and other tribal organizations to implement healthy eating and active living programs, and commercial tobacco prevention programming and policies
    • Identify and conduct commercial tobacco prevention outreach and education to non-clinical settings
    • Participate in the development and implementation of a youth commercial tobacco prevention program in schools.
    • Work with community partners to develop and/or implement strategies that aid in obesity prevention and nutrition education
    • Gather data and develop health education initiatives aimed at promoting healthy lifestyles, wellness, and a healthy environment
    • Participate in health fairs
    • Coordinate health information projects such newsletters, informational displays, and community health events
    • Design and distribute health education materials that are culturally appropriate
    • Support social media promotion of programming
    • Attend required trainings and meetings, both in person and online, in accordance with grant funding
    • Complete reporting and evaluation as related to deliverables
    • Perform other duties as assigned.
